Unit Information:
Neurosurgical/Neuroscience Med/Surgical/step down unit---40% of patients come from the Neuro Critical Care after an acute event and about 30% go to Rehab facilities upon discharge. Age ranges from 15-100+. Wide variety of Neuro trauma, MVA, stroke, seizure, brain and spinal cord injuries and insults along with Crani's for tumors, laminectomies, shunts for hydrocephalus. Early mobility and rehab a significant focus--work daily with therapies.
- In and out caths/lines/g-tubes/occasional lumbar punctures/occasional trachs, PCA pumps, wound vacs,
- Nurses do primary care with excellent team support. Charge Nurse usually takes a reduced assignment to better support the team.
- 2-3 surgeries per day/Neuro Critical Care is our primary feeder unit. Most patients we treat have had an acute neuro-trauma type injury or insult to the brain or spinal cord.
